> Does Artemis refuse new connections with an error/exception?

It depends on what you mean. The broker will refuse to allow the new
connection, and it will throw an
org.apache.activemq.artemis.api.core.ActiveMQSessionCreationException
internally. However, how exactly that error is translated to the client
will depend on the protocol that client is using and also how the client
implementation deals with what is returned. ActiveMQ Artemis supports
OpenWire, core, AMQP, STOMP, & MQTT. Are you concerned with a particular
protocol and client implementation?
